How To Decorate Your Interior With Blush Pink

Who doesn’t love an opportunity to redecorate? This season the color you need is blush pink or rose quartz. From accents on your desk to striking pieces that will completely change the look and feel of your room, check out how to use the must have color of spring/summer 2016.

Blush pink  isn’t an intimidating color, it should transform any space into a chilled boudoir. Despite the connotations, it doesn’t have to be a primarily feminine color, a copper hue can be added to any space to give it a more chic edge.

  1. I love the blush pink trend, and agree that it can be a little challenging to incorporate it into, say, a bedroom area that is shared by both genders. But, there are solutions. For example, blush and cool gray can be used together to blend the feminine and the masculine.
    I did use blush paint to spruce up the color on a beige bathroom wall, and it was met with no resistance because it was really a similar color family.
